What are Home Movies by One True Media? | ||
TiVo and One True Media have teamed up to provide you with a breakthrough video service designed to provide friends and family scattered across the country with an easy way to share your Video and Photo Montages, by sending them directly to their TiVo DVR to play on their TV! One True Media users create video montages from their personal photos and video clips. At the OTM site, they can add various transitions, captions, effects and music to deliver a broadcast quality video to their very own personalized TiVo channel. Friends and family can then view the video montage on their TV, at their convenience. | ||
How does Home Movies by One True Media work? | ||
Easy. Once you create your video montage at OneTrueMedia.com, you can share it on your own personal TiVo channel. Just give your private TiVo Code to the TiVo subscribers of your choice, so they can access your uploaded Home Movies. Once downloaded to their TiVo DVR, your friends and family will find your video montages in the “Home Movies by One True Media” folder located within the Music, Photos, Products & More folder on TiVo Central. To view your channel, a viewer simply enters your private Channel Code (provided in the email that you send them). Once the channel is set up, a code doesn’t need to ever be re-entered. Viewers will have the choice to individually download Video Montages or to create a Season Pass. When they're ready to watch, viewers simply go to the Now Playing list and open Home Movies by One True Media. Viewers can also get a Season Pass to receive all future montages or download one video at a time, just like any other show TiVo records. | ||
Which TiVo DVRs are compatible with Home Movies by One True Media? | ||
To view One True Media Video Montages, viewers need broadband-connected TiVo Series2 and Series3 boxes. For help with your broadband connection, see our “Getting Started" page. | ||
Do I need a TiVo subscription to use Home Movies by One True Media? | ||
While you do not need a subscription to TiVo service to create video montages or to create your personal TiVo channel. Access to TiVo Service is required in order to view the Home Movie Video Montages with your Series2 or Series3 TiVo DVR. | ||

What if one of my videos is accidentally deleted from a TiVo folder? | ||
All One True Media videos are accessible at anytime in your Music, Photos, Products & More folder on TiVo Central. Just find the video that you would like to view again and re-download it. Once downloaded, the video will appear in your Home Movies by One True Media folder in your Now Playing List. | ||
Where can I find One True Media Home Movies on my TiVo DVR? | ||
You will find all your One True Media videos in your Now Playing List – where you’d look to find all of your favorite shows! Customized sub-folders will be available for easy categorization within your list. | ||
How long does it take to download a Video Montage to a TiVo DVR? | ||
In most cases, you can start receiving videos 24 hours after you establish your private TiVo channel. If a viewer creates a Season Pass, any new video montage will appear in their Now Playing list after TiVo makes its nightly call to the services, like any other TiVocast. | ||
